What you’ll do Become part of an iconic brand that is set to revolutionize the electric pick-up truck & rugged SUV marketplace by achieving the following: Lead execution of the data-driven, AI-enabled Quality roadmap by translating defined Quality objectives into team priorities, work plans, and scalable digital solutions that improve transparency, cost efficiency, and decision-making across Quality domains. Drive the creation of lean Quality processes through automation and AI-supported solutions, minimizing manual effort, accelerating response times, and delivering measurable value through scalable AI use-cases, aligned with overhead and long-term cost-optimization targets. Partner with Quality, IT, data governance, and cybersecurity stakeholders to evaluate, recommend, and implement digital tools and platform solutions that support Quality priorities and align with enterprise standards. Manage the development, integration, and continuous improvement of Quality KPI dashboards and reporting frameworks across production, supplier quality, and field monitoring to support proactive risk identification and performance visibility. Develop and maintain automated reporting, escalation workflows, and team processes that provide timely insights and support data-informed decisions by Quality leadership. Build and lead a high-performing Quality AI Center of Excellence, managing Data Engineers & Scientists to design, develop and scale digital solutions, while ensuring cross-alignment and prioritization of Quality use cases with internal and external stakeholders at Scout (e.g. Production, IT), VW Group (Group IT), and Business Units in Quality. Establish an IT-based, cross-functional problem-resolution process — including root cause analysis (RCA), escalation management, and effectiveness tracking of corrective actions. Reduce operational complexity and ensure a lean, consistent approach to issue resolution. Ensure rigorous documentation of quality issues, decisions, and lessons learned , integrating findings into future product and process improvements to solidify Scout’s credibility and readiness through launch and ramp-up.
